Fisheries and Oceans Canada had predicted about five million Fraser River sockeye would return in 2019, but only 600,000 made it.

“We had made an estimate of the number at about 870,000, so we were much more accurate,” said Beamish. “We didn’t catch that many fish in the survey, but it was over a large enough area that we knew what to expect.”
 
Beamish is a DFO scientist, or was at least. Maybe this will lead to development of more accurate stock assessment methods but he seems to think it is too early to know. Makes sense that information closer to the return time would be more accurate and, with DNA testing getting quicker and cheaper, being able to assess stocks when they are mixed is becoming more reliable.
